Nonprofits are invited to submit grant requests to The Foundation for Delaware County as it launches its third competitive grantmaking cycle.

A formal Request for Proposals (RFP) is available on its website www.delcofoundation.org.

Applications are due online Feb. 9, 2021 with awards to be announced in late April 2021.

The grants awarded through this competitive grant process will advance the foundation’s goal to improve the health and quality of life of children and families in Delaware County.

For the current funding cycle, the foundation will consider awarding grant funds in the following priority areas designed to address many social determinants of health:

  • Children’s Health and Well-Being (Infants to ages 18)
  • Community and Economic Development
  • Food Security
  • Hospice and Home Care

There will be a limited number of multi-year grants (up to 3 years) available).

Organizations can apply for only ONE grant per year or a multi-year period. All grant proceeds must be used to provide programs and services in Delaware County.

Types of proposals that will be considered include: core operating support, program or project support, capacity building, advocacy and awareness, and capital expenditures.
